Nov. 8, 2013 - PRLog -- As stated in the report "Infrastructure and Capital Investment 2012-16: Medium Term Exchequer Framework" from the Irish Department of Expenditure and Reform published in 2011, "The PPP model has been used to deliver a major roads programme, schools and other education facilities and accommodation projects, Convention Centre Dublin, and the Criminal Courts Complex. PPPs will continue to have a role to play in the delivery of key social infrastructure projects to meet remaining deficits in particular additional Schools Bundles and projects in the Health Sector. The private funding market has, however, been particularly challenging for the past number of years." (http://per.gov.ie/wp-content/uploads/Infrastructure-and-Capital-Investment-2012-2016.pdf)
